A sign that weather may be changing for the worse is the sudden increase in wind speed, often accompanied by darkening skies or the appearance of ominous clouds. Additionally, a drop in temperature can indicate an approaching storm. The presence of distant thunder or a noticeable shift in humidity are also strong indicators of worsening weather conditions.

Is a sudden drop in temperature a sign that weather may be changing for the worse?

Not always, you need to take barometric pressure into account, the sudden drop signifies that a new weather system has moved in, whether it is high or low pressure will determine whether it is good or bad
